Ferrite Pot Magnets
Ferrite pot magnets (cup magnets) use a ceramic (ferrite) magnet insert encased in a steel cup. They provide a cost-effective magnetic holding solution with good corrosion resistance and thermal stability, ideal for general-purpose mounting and retention tasks.
What Are Ferrite Pot Magnets?
Ferrite pot magnets consist of a ferrite ring magnet encased in a steel shell that concentrates and strengthens their magnetic field. The pot structure enhances pull force on the active surface while shielding other sides, creating a controlled magnetic field ideal for holding, mounting, and positioning applications.
Advantages
- Reliable holding force with minimal performance loss
- High durability in outdoor and high-temperature conditions
- Low-cost alternative for large-scale industrial deployment
- Available in multiple mounting styles such as threaded holes, hooks, and countersunk designs

Industrial Applications
Signage and display mounting
Cabinet and panel closures
Retail fixtures and shelving
Machine guards and safety panels
Light-duty fixtures in workshops
DIY home organization projects
